Position: Premier Banker- Southington- Main Street

Job Summary

The Premier Banker is an experienced banker who serves as the primary contact for a complex portfolio of mass affluent clients. The role focuses on growing, deepening, and retaining client relationships by delivering TD’s model of convenience, sales, and advice through a personalized, connected experience.

Responsibilities
  • Grow, deepen, and retain strong relationships with a mass affluent book of business by proactively managing and addressing banking needs.
  • Demonstrate proficiency and in-depth knowledge in banking and credit products, explaining solutions fluently to clients and acting as liaison with internal partners (small business, wealth, commercial, lending).
  • Acquire, retain, and deepen relationships with new mass affluent clients through referrals, leads, and outbound prospecting.
  • Proactively engage in client outreach via phone, email, appointments, and other means; conduct needs‑based conversations, review financial information, suggest solutions, and coordinate introductions with appropriate partners.
  • Deliver excellent client service, review moderately complex client concerns, and appropriately escalates banking related issues or risks.
  • Adhere to all relevant Retail/Wealth policies, procedures, FINRA and regulatory banking requirements.
  • Engage in conversations with clients about loan products; facilitate application intake while maintaining an active NMLS registration.
  • Establish and maintain strong working relationships with partners through ongoing meetings and collaboration to identify areas for relationship deepening.
  • Provide ongoing coaching and feedback to bank staff on effective methods to articulate the program’s value and refer mass affluent clients.
  • Implement TD’s client Identification Program (CIP) with associated due diligence requirements.
  • Maintain adherence to TD Bank & TD Wealth policies, procedures, AML procedures, and regulatory compliance.
Qualifications
  • HS Diploma or GED (required);
    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ience preferred.
  • 2+ years financial/banking experience.
  • Successful completion of the Securities Industry Essentials Exam (SIE);
    Life & Health license preferred.
  • Knowledge and experience with retail and small business banking; experience interacting with Mass Affluent and high net worth clients.
  • Consultative sales experience required.
  • Active registration status with NMLS upon hire.
  • Understanding and experience with loan product application intake.
  • Strong client service skills and ability to conduct routine and multi‑step transactions.
  • Strong communication, relationship building, organizational, and problem‑solving skills.
  • Proficiency with client relationship tools and ability to use them to engage in needs‑based conversations.
  • High energy level, self‑starter, and ability to work independently and collaboratively.
Key Accountabilities & Regulatory Requirements
  • Position is classified as Loan Originator under Regulation Z and SAFE Act; must be eligible for registration as a registered mortgage loan originator with NMLS.
  • Must meet satisfactory results on a criminal and credit check and comply with required certification statements.
Physical Requirements
  • Perform sedentary office work, operating standard office equipment, standing, walking, lifting 25 lbs.
  • Occasional domestic travel; no international travel required.
